That's almost literally Mermin's slogan for the view, which he
also advocates, "Relations without relata." But are relations
abstracted away from relata really any different from numbers
abstracted from things counted?
Of course we can abstract relations from relata and numbers from
things, just as we can abstract the Cheshire cat's grin from the cat.
It doesn't mean that the grin can exist without the cat.
If you ask the same question about numbers it seems that maybe they can
exist because there are a lot of different pairs and without one of them
the number 2 can count another pair. But can 2 exist if there are no
pairs to count, or no counters to identify pairs?
